Introduction
The incentive spirometer is a medical plastic device that allows you when taking deep breath and exhaling, it expands your lungs. It consists of a mouthpiece, a flexible tubing, a piston, a breathing coach indicator, a yellow indicator and a barrel. It uses to assist patient after surgery or any person who want to improve their lungs function especially patient or any person who is restricted to be in bed for many days. An incentive spirometer is a device that our patients use to improve the function of their lungs. This main underlying principle is that breathing can be exercised to train the expansion of lungs capacity (Potter, Perry, Stockert, & Hall, 2013). Patients who qualify for this intervention include those who have recently had a surgery, were under anesthesia, or have been placed on bed rest. Our main concern here is that these situations create opportunity for less activity within the lungs, which can put the patient at risk for pneumonia.

Martin Wright developed the mechanical peak flow meter in 1959, it has been used to monitor serial lung function in asthmatics because it is inexpensive, compact, easy to use, and it provides an objective measure of lung function (Ayala et.al, 2014, p.84). Moreover, the peak flow meter has evolved since its creation almost 60 years ago, in terms of both size and precision. In addition, patients can be taught to use the peak flow meter and monitor their own lung function to determine when to use different medications as directed by an asthma action plan, which is constructed by the patient’s physician and or caregivers. Spirometry is the most popular lung function test. The patient performs a maximal inhalation and then forcefully exhales as quickly and as long as they are able. The spirometer measures the volume of the air exhaled by patients. These measurements are taken at two intervals. The first measurement is the forced expiratory volume in one second (FEV1), records the volume of air exhaled after one second.
